Factors Influencing Cost
Dead tree removal in Manchester, NH, involves assessing the size and location of the tree, the materials needed, and the scope of work required to safely eliminate the hazard. Understanding typical project considerations can help homeowners and property managers plan accordingly and compare service options effectively.
- Materials involved: Use of chainsaws, ropes, and safety equipment to cut and lower tree sections.
- Size and scope: Ranges from small, single-stem trees to large, multi-trunk specimens requiring extensive work.
- Labor complexity: Varies based on tree height, proximity to structures, and accessibility, influencing the level of effort needed.
- Permitting considerations: May require local permits, especially for trees near public areas or protected zones in Manchester.
- Additional services: Stump grinding, wood removal, and debris cleanup are often included or offered as extras.
